Search a number
-
+
311014131320 = 23541672830489
BaseRepresentation
bin1001000011010011110…
…00110000011001111000
31002201210002221212111202
410201221320300121320
520043424104200240
6354513344113332
731320135332354
oct4415170603170
91081702855452
10311014131320
1110a99a407172
125033a005848
1323436963389
14110a5c50464
1581545e0315
hex4869e30678

311014131320 has 64 divisors (see below), whose sum is σ = 727549149600. Its totient is φ = 119559813120.

The previous prime is 311014131299. The next prime is 311014131359. The reversal of 311014131320 is 23131410113.

It is a Harshad number since it is a multiple of its sum of digits (20).

It is a junction number, because it is equal to n+sod(n) for n = 311014131292 and 311014131301.

It is a congruent number.

It is an unprimeable number.

It is a pernicious number, because its binary representation contains a prime number (17) of ones.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 1305365 + ... + 1525124.

Almost surely, 2311014131320 is an apocalyptic number.

It is an amenable number.

311014131320 is an abundant number, since it is smaller than the sum of its proper divisors (416535018280).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

311014131320 is a wasteful number, since it uses less digits than its factorization.

311014131320 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 2830608 (or 2830604 counting only the distinct ones).

The product of its (nonzero) digits is 216, while the sum is 20.

Adding to 311014131320 its reverse (23131410113), we get a palindrome (334145541433).

The spelling of 311014131320 in words is "three hundred eleven billion, fourteen million, one hundred thirty-one thousand, three hundred twenty".

Divisors: 1 2 4 5 8 10 20 40 41 67 82 134 164 205 268 328 335 410 536 670 820 1340 1640 2680 2747 5494 10988 13735 21976 27470 54940 109880 2830489 5660978 11321956 14152445 22643912 28304890 56609780 113219560 116050049 189642763 232100098 379285526 464200196 580250245 758571052 928400392 948213815 1160500490 1517142104 1896427630 2321000980 3792855260 4642001960 7585710520 7775353283 15550706566 31101413132 38876766415 62202826264 77753532830 155507065660 311014131320